We have had an incredibly fun and busy week in Year 5!

In science we recreated a to scale version of the solar system. Shrunk down by a scale of 100,000,000,000km to cm. The children used metre sticks and trundle wheels to measure out the distances.

Here are some photos to show what it looked like. The children were surprised by how big the sun was in comparison to the rest of the planets and by how far apart the outer planets were.

In English we have been learning about Greek Myths.

We then performed Theseus and the Minotaur as a freeze frame. The children worked well together to organise their parts and recreate different scenes from the story.

The children then wrote a precis of the story. We have been impressed by their effort in writing so far this year.

In Maths we have continued to work on place value. Children have been partitioning and ordering numbers up to 1 million. Homewrok has been set to order and compare large numbers.
